Is Minecraft Herobrine a virus?

Herobrine may not be a virus in reality, but his legend spread like one. He became the topic of numerous threads on the Minecraft Forums, receiving a mix of alleged player sightings and comments from other posters that he was obviously fake.

When was the first Herobrine sighting?

The First Herobrine Sighting. The first sighting of Herobrine dates back to 2010. This came in the form of a single image detailing the encounter.

What happened to Herobrine in Minecraft Xbox 360?

In an update for Xbox 360 on July 13, 2012, Herobrine was removed from the Xbox 360 Edition of Minecraft for the first time. Legacy Console Edition On the Legacy Console Editions, Herobrine is mentioned on one of the splash messages.

Why does Herobrine have a crooked head?

Herobrine is often portrayed with his head crooked or twitching. This is likely due to him being seen moreso as a virus/creepy entity in Minecraft, rather than a ghost. Herobrine is able to build and destroy in Minecraft. The original image states the player found long 2×2 tunnels, small pyramids in the middle of the ocean and trees with no leaves.

How to get @s player_head Herobrine?

Herobrine was one of the skins that could be obtained through this system by using the command /give @s player_head{SkullOwner:MHF_Herobrine}. The skin used to show Herobrine without a beard, which was not canon to Herobrine’s origins in both the the creepypasta and the Copeland stream, as well as official promotional materials Mojang often use.
